Ubiquiti ENVR-Core Enterprise Network Video Recorder Core
The Ubiquiti ENVR-Core is a 3U rackmount enterprise network video recorder designed for large-scale surveillance deployments. It supports up to 500 HD or 300 4K cameras with high-density video processing, redundant power, and scalable storage expansion for campus and multi-site environments.
Product Specifications
| Specification | Details |
|---|---|
| Overview | |
| Product Type | Enterprise network video recorder |
| Model | ENVR-Core |
| Brand | Ubiquiti |
| Form Factor | 3U rack mount |
| Management Application | UniFi Protect, UniFi Access |
| Managed Cameras | • 500 HD • 400 2K • 300 4K |
| Managed Access Hubs | 300+ |
| Storage Capacity | 16 × 3.5 inch drive bays |
| Data Protection | Yes |
| Vantage Point | Yes |
| Door Access Support | Yes |
| Networking | |
| Networking Interface | • 2 × 25G SFP28 (25G 10G 1G) • 1 × GbE RJ45 management (1G 100M) |
| Expansion Port | 2 × SFF-8644 (24G) |
| Hardware | |
| Processor | 128-core Arm v8.2 at 2.6 GHz |
| Memory | 64 GB |
| Drive Support | • 16 × 2.5 inch or 3.5 inch HDD SSD • Expansion up to 48 total drives |
| Max Drive Power Budget | 313 W |
| Enclosure Material | SGCC steel |
| Mount Material | Aluminum |
| Slide Rails | Supports 482.6 mm (19 inch) racks, post depth 600 to 1066 mm (23.6 to 42 inches), square holes 9.5 × 9.5 mm |
| Faceplate | Supports UACC-3U-Bezel-Lite included |
| LEDs | • SFP28 • HDD • System • Expansion port • CRPS |
| Management Interface | Ethernet, Bluetooth |
| Weight | • Without rails: 20.5 kg (45.2 lb) • With rails: 23.4 kg (51.6 lb) |
| Power | |
| Power Method | 2 × AC input 100 to 240V, 7A max, 50 60 Hz |
| Power Supply | Hot-swappable 550W CRPS |
| Power Redundancy | Yes |
| Max Power Consumption | 237 W |
| Environmental | |
| Operating Temperature | 10°C to 35°C (50°F to 95°F) |
| Operating Humidity | 20% to 90% non-condensing |
| Certifications | |
| NDAA Compliant | Yes |
| Certifications | CE, FCC, IC |
